Joules to Megaelectronvolts: 1 J equals 6.24151e+12 MeV. To convert joules to megaelectronvolts, multiply by 6.24151e+12 (MeV = J × 6,241,509,074,461). For example, 10 J = 6.24151e+13 MeV.
How to Convert Joules to Megaelectronvolts
To convert from joules to megaelectronvolts, multiply the value by 6.24151e+12. The conversion is linear, meaning doubling the input doubles the output.
Conversion Formula
- Joules to Megaelectronvolts:
MeV = J × 6,241,509,074,461 - Megaelectronvolts to Joules:
J = MeV ÷ 6,241,509,074,461

Understanding the Units
What is a Joule?
The joule is the SI derived unit of energy, equal to the work done by a force of one newton acting through a distance of one meter (1 J = 1 N·m = 1 W·s).
Named after James Prescott Joule (1818–1889), the English physicist who demonstrated the mechanical equivalent of heat.
Common contexts: physics, chemistry, engineering.
What is a Megaelectronvolt?
A megaelectronvolt equals one million electronvolts (10⁶ eV).
Common contexts: nuclear physics, gamma-ray spectroscopy.
